x402b is a payment protocol within the Pieverse system, designed to help AI Agents complete on-chain transactions without requiring users to pay Gas directly. Through fee abstraction and an agent execution model, it shifts Gas payment away from the user side and toward the system or service layer, lowering the barrier to Web3 adoption. Combined with automated execution logic, x402b allows AI Agents to complete transaction tasks continuously while generating auditable on-chain records.

Gensyn is a decentralized compute network designed to distribute AI model training tasks. By breaking training tasks apart and assigning them to different nodes, it enables distributed collaborative training. As AI models continue to grow in scale, centralized computing resources alone are increasingly unable to meet training demand. Compute Networks such as Gensyn are being used to connect computing resources around the world.

AWE Network and Virtuals Protocol both belong to the AI Agent infrastructure sector, but they serve different purposes. AWE Network focuses on Autonomous Worlds infrastructure, using the Autonomous Worlds Engine to support multi-agent collaboration and on-chain autonomous environments. Virtuals Protocol, by contrast, places more emphasis on the issuance, deployment, and tokenization of AI Agents, helping developers quickly create on-chain AI Agents. At the infrastructure level, AWE is closer to an “operating system for autonomous worlds,” while Virtuals is more like an “AI Agent launchpad.”
